Heroes actor Milo Ventimiglia sports this season’s sharpest khaki business suits in the March issue of GQ. In a rather short interview with Mickey Rapkin, Milo talks about growing up, GQ’s Obsession of the Year, and lookin' Sly at 60. A few more pics after the jump... Full interview and pics here.
It seems like you’ve aged a decade since the first season of ‘Heroes.’ What gives?
Going through my twenties playing a teenager was kind of rough. I just finally put on a little man-weight. My face changed. Nothing I could do about it, man. It was a fucking train I could not stop.
Hayden was GQ’s Obsession of the Year. Did you like those photos?
Yes, I did. They were very nice.
Last question: You played Stallone’s son in ‘Rocky Balboa.’ Great movie. But the guy is starting to look like a Picasso. What’s that face look like up close?
He’s a good-looking guy. If I look like Sly at 60, I’ll be pretty happy myself.
